Show Notes

The number of complaints going to the Office of the Ombudsman is soaring to record heights.

Its annual report finds more than eight thousand Official information complaints - a 30 percent increase.

The office also received 278 protected disclosures under the whistleblower law - up 26 percent.

Chief Ombudsman John Allen told Mike Hosking OIAs are an attractive option for people trying to raise issues with the Government.

He says public confidence in Government generally is on the decline and people are under a huge amount of pressure with cost of living.
